The latest: All over the world, including Ecuador, raw cotton has flown up 18% in cost. To compound that, Ecuador used to enjoy a much smaller tariff rate than other countries, for being a partner with USA in the fight against drugs. They have just lost that standing, and import tariffs from Ecuador have jumped from a miniscule token amount to 23%! That adds almost a 3rd to the cost of an item if you include the amount of freight from South America. The Pro Series! US grown Pima Cotton is then hand woven in Ecuador on virgin looms (no synthetics ever touch the loom). The weave is thick and tactile and has a marvelous hand hewn look and feel. It will stand up to just about any wear you can dish out (aside from battle wounds). Historically accurate with no elastic, only drawstring at neck and wrists. Not overly full sleeves. Natural deep ivory color. For super fullness of sleeves, just go with a bigger size. Perfect for Renaissance Faire performers that are expected to look authentic. A favorite of the Pirate Dinner Cruise Staff as these can be washed over and over again. Bust measurement A-lines out to the hips, so the hips are always 4 inches bigger than the bust. Available up to 4X. Measurements given are the actual fabric, not your bust size. Order with plenty of room for fullness.
